Top 5 Smoothboard Air Upgrades and Accessories You Need
-
Protective Carry Case
- Why: Keeps the Smoothboard Air safe from dings, scratches, and moisture during transport.
- What to look for: Padded interior, reinforced shell, water-resistant exterior, and compartments for charger and tools.
- Quick tip: Choose a case with a shoulder strap and back carry option for commuting.
-
Spare Charger & Fast Charger
- Why: Reduces downtime between rides and gives a backup if the stock charger fails. A fast charger (if supported by the board) shortens recharge time.
- What to look for: Official or OEM-compatible chargers with correct voltage/amperage and safety certifications (UL/CE).
- Quick tip: Label chargers and keep one at home and one at work.
-
Upgraded Wheels (if compatible)
- Why: Better wheels can improve ride comfort, grip, and durability—especially useful for rough urban surfaces.
- What to look for: Material (urethane quality), diameter for obstacle clearance, and compatibility with Smoothboard Air hubs.
- Quick tip: Larger, softer wheels increase comfort but may slightly reduce top speed.
-
Protective Bumpers and Deck Grip Tape
- Why: Prevents cosmetic damage and improves foot traction for safer riding.
- What to look for: Rubber or silicone bumpers that match mounting points; high-grit grip tape cut to board dimensions.
- Quick tip: Apply grip tape carefully to avoid bubbles; trim edges cleanly for a professional look.
-
Essential Tool Kit & Replacement Parts
- Why: Enables on-the-spot repairs and routine maintenance (tightening bolts, replacing bearings, swapping belts).
- What to look for: Multi-tool with Allen keys, torque wrench or torque-limited driver, spare bolts, bearings, and fuses specific to Smoothboard Air.
- Quick tip: Pack a small tire patch kit and a compact pump if your model uses pneumatic tires.
